The last seven days have been eXcellent. Started out with hauling a load from San Diego to Fernley, NV, a small town 30 miles east of Reno. I stopped in Reno and had breakfast with Bean. It was too cold to work for Bean so he went fly fishing. From there I went to Fresno to pick up for Ft Worth. I just skirted the storm that was to really mess up Oklahoma. I came up to the storm approaching Ft Worth again and swapped loads with one of our drivers in Sweetwater, TX with a load for Tracy, CA. Unloaded in Tracy and now I'm doing my 34 hours. You can only drive so many hours a day or week and when you get to the max, you can lay over for 34 hours and start over. I emptied out Tracy on the 16th, had dinner with Terry that night in San Jose, and had dinner last night with Mopar Tony. Went for a short ride with Tony also. He rode his Kaw triple while I rode his 79 X. Loved the smell, I followed him all the way. I don't think it's considered pollution when you run bean oil in 2 strokes.
